58408980143 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 58408980144. Its totient is φ = 58408980142.

The previous prime is 58408980107. The next prime is 58408980187. The reversal of 58408980143 is 34108980485.

It is a weak prime.

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 58408980143 - 28 = 58408979887 is a prime.

It is a super-2 number, since 2×584089801432 (a number of 22 digits) contains 22 as substring.

It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 58408980091 and 58408980100.

It is a congruent number.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(58408989143) by changing a digit.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 29204490071 + 29204490072.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(29204490072).

Almost surely, 258408980143 is an apocalyptic number.

58408980143 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).

58408980143 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.

58408980143 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.

The product of its (nonzero) digits is 1105920, while the sum is 50.

The spelling of 58408980143 in words is "fifty-eight billion, four hundred eight million, nine hundred eighty thousand, one hundred forty-three".
